Effect of Visual and Sound Cues on Balance and Walking Speed in Senior Citizens of age ranging from 65-74 years.

Impact of Visual and Auditory Cues on Postural Sway and Gait Speed in Community Dwelling Elderly Individuals Aged 65-74years - A Randomized Control Trial. - NIL

Eligibility

Inclusion criteria

Inclusion criteria: 1. Able to stand and walk independently. 2. Corrected refractive error (with or without spectacle). 3. Able to hear instructions given by a physiotherapist with or without a hearing aid. 4. Understand and follow the commands given by a physiotherapist.

Exclusion criteria

Exclusion criteria: 1. History of vertigo. 2. Individuals with neurological and/or musculoskeletal manifestations. 3. Recent lower limb or spine surgery in the past 6 months.

Design outcomes

Primary

MeasureTime frame
1. Sway area in cm sq. and sway velocity in cm per second 2. Gait speed in meter per second 3. Timed up and Go testTimepoint: Pre therapy and 4 weeks post therapy
